  18. What is the interest rate for Public Provident Fund (PPF) for Oct-Dec Quarter?
    A) 7.4%
    B) 7.1%
    C) 7.3%
    D) 7.5%
    View Answer
    Option B
    Explanation:

    Small Savings Schemes with Interest Rates for Oct-Dec Quarter
    Senior Citizen Savings Scheme (SCSS)- 7.4 percent.
    Sukanya Samriddhi Yojana Scheme (SSYS)- 7.6 percent.
    Kisan Vikas Patra (KVP)- 6.9 percent.
    Public Provident Fund (PPF) – 7.1 percent.
    National Savings Certificates (NSC)- 6.8 percent.
    Post Office Monthly Income Scheme (MIS)- 6.6 percent.
